As the AFL season heats up, we find ourselves at a pivotal moment for several teams, with the Western Bulldogs aiming to bounce back and secure a top-six spot. The Bulldogs' recent form has been a rollercoaster, with impressive wins against top contenders followed by lackluster performances. This inconsistency has left them stuck in the middle of the ladder, a frustrating position for a team with such potential.
One of the key takeaways from the Bulldogs' recent games is their need to take more risks and utilize their offensive firepower. With only the bottom-four teams scoring fewer points this year, it's clear that the Bulldogs have the ability to dominate, but they must find the right balance between caution and aggression.
On the other side of the field, the West Coast Eagles present an intriguing challenge. Despite notching up wins, the Eagles have shown signs of improvement, especially in their recent game against Adelaide. They managed to match the Crows for almost three quarters, a promising display that suggests they're on the cusp of turning their season around.
The Bulldogs' injury woes have also impacted their performance, with key defensive players Nick Coffield and Connor Budarick ruled out. However, the return of Rhylee West and the inclusion of Jedd Busslinger and Bailey Williams provide a boost to their backline. West Coast, unchanged from their last game, will be looking to capitalize on the Bulldogs' shaky form.
